The document reports that Barcelona has seen economic recovery in 2010 and maintained its strong international positioning, while continuing efforts to transition towards a knowledge-based economy through major projects like 22@ and the Barcelona Economic Triangle. Barcelona coordinates joint actions between public and private stakeholders to consolidate its brand and competitiveness. It also benefits from cooperation between different levels of government through instruments like the Barcelona Strategic Metropolitan Plan 2020.

Barcelona has maintained a solid competitive position among top European cities despite the global economic recession. In 2009, Barcelona recovered its position as the fourth best city for businesses in Europe. It also remained the top city for quality of life for workers and made the most progress. The city is dealing with the recession through high investment, support for companies and job creation, and maintaining its long-term strategy for a new economic growth model based on knowledge, creativity, innovation and sustainability. Proactive measures by the city have helped it weather the difficult economic circumstances.

Hinduism is one of the world's oldest religions originating around 3,000 BCE in India. It is a diverse set of traditions that worship deities and seek liberation (moksha) through various paths including karma yoga (selfless service), bhakti yoga (devotion), jnana yoga (knowledge), and raja yoga (meditation). The core beliefs include samsara (cycle of rebirth), karma (law of cause and effect), dharma (duty), and ahimsa (non-violence). Popular expressions of Hinduism include worshipping deities like Krishna, Shiva, Vishnu and attending temples and festivals.
